Help!...quick!

hey guys well i have a problem with my car...some how my gauge lights and all of the lights like the defroster etc. arent working...so im wondering if its the fuse or some wiring problems.
also when i turn on the defroster my exhaust makes a louder sound. so im wondering wut that is all about too.

First I'd definitely check the fuse, then check the wiring between the gauge cluster and where they run into the ECU or their place in the engine bay. Use a meter to see if you're getting 12 volt on the suspected wire. If the wiring is good, then check the harness. If the harness is good, then check the actual unit itself (the gauge cluster and other lights).

Check your dimmer switch too. Hopefully it's just a fuse. Electrical problems are a pain in the ***.
